By exterior angle theorem, we have;
∠DBE = ∠H + ∠HEB = ∠ECD = ∠H + ∠HDC
∴ ∠H + ∠HEB = ∠H + ∠HDC
By addition property of equality, we have
∠HEB = ∠HDC
∠H = ∠H by reflexive property
∴ ΔHCD ~ ΔHEB by Angle Angle AA similarity postulate
∴ HE/HD = EB/DC, by the definition of similarity
Therefore, by cross multiplication, we have;
HE × DC = EB × HD
Therefore, by commutative property of multiplication, we have;
HE × DC = HD × EB

7^8 x 7^3 x 7^4 / 7^9 7^5
= 7^(8+3+4) / 7^(9+5)
= 7^15 / 7^14
= 7^(15-14)
= 7.
When the bases of the numbers are the same when multiplying numbers with exponents, you can just add the exponents like so:
7^8 x 7^3 x 7^4= 7^15
Now, look at the rest of the simplified equation and do the same to the denominator:
7^15 / 7^9 x 7^5 ⇒ 7^15/ 7^14
When the bases are the same in the fraction, you are allowed to subtract the exponents. This will lead you to the simplified answer = 7^15-14 = 7^1 = 7

cos is positive at first and fourth quadrant
so, cos (-x) = cos (x)
also, cos(180-x) = -cos x
cos (180+x) = -cos x
cos (-170°) = cos (170°)
cos(170°) = cos (180° - 10°)
= - cos 10°
